Local business directory near me with reviews

Search

All organizations in the category Embroidery shop, in the city New Smyrna Beach

Organization
Be
Beach Embroidery & Screen Prin...

806 E 3rd Ave, New Smyrna Beach, FL 32169, United States

Go to
Organization